**Q: Why does the replica-lag alarm fire when my plugin runs bulk writes?**

The Driftgauge alarm on Pallasdb read replicas triggers above 30s lag. Plugin bulk writes should be chunked under 5k rows. Don't retry on lag errors; back off instead. If your plugin sandbox loses its replica session entirely, re-initialize it from the Pallasdb console, which will ask for the recovery passphrase shown below.

recovery phrase for fawif-tajeg: norael-aldmir-casir-brivan-ulaion

Subject: Key rotation — Nightcart backfill scheduler

Support team, a quick notice: we rotated the credentials used by Nightcart, the scheduler that runs our nightly data backfills. If customers report stale dashboards tomorrow morning, first confirm the backfill jobs completed rather than escalating immediately. The old key is revoked as of tonight's run. Any tooling you use to query job status against the scheduler needs the updated credential. The new key for the scheduler service is included below.

API key for yahig-tadup: kto7_ubizbYm

Quarterly Planning Note — Revised Commission Scheme

For the board: the revised sales-commission scheme at Thornquay Instruments takes effect next quarter. Base rates drop two points, offset by accelerators above 110% of target. Modelling suggests a neutral cost impact and stronger incentives on the Larkfield product line. The confidential business-plan note follows directly below.

internal memo for kaduf-baduf: Only 35 of the 378 pilot accounts renewed Holir, so a churn review is set for June 11. Eliielax Group is in early talks to buy Silaelix Group for about $142.1 million.

## Migrating off Hearthqueue

We are replacing the homegrown Hearthqueue job runner with the managed Ferrow scheduler. During the transition, both systems run in shadow mode; compare the reconciliation report daily before cutting traffic. The legacy admin panel remains needed for draining old jobs, and its sealed credential store can only be reopened with the recovery passphrase recorded directly beneath this note.

vault phrase of hahop-badug = novvan-ulaion-zorius-noviel-gorwyn-casix-tamys